    Position Overview:

    The Cloud Infrastructure DevSecOps Engineer 2 position will focus on all aspects of design, analysis, implementation and support of systems, software or other solutions pertaining to deploying capabilities to cloud systems. The candidate will work within a team of software and IT engineers to build high performance, cloud-based solutions.

    Major functions:

    • Support the development of open architectures and applications, infrastructure, and cloud platforms to ensure they are best suited for Cloud deployment and consumption.
    • Support the adoption of Cloud best practices and supporting technologies to enable such capabilities as DevSecOps, Big Data/Analytics, AI, Micro-Services.
    • Support the architecture, design, development, troubleshoot, and implementation of cloud solutions.
    • Work closely with the Information Technology Security team to ensure the applications and solutions designed and deployed are secure and compliant.
    • Effectively Interface with Customer personnel at varying organizational levels.
    • Must be self-motivated and expected to work independently with minimal supervision.
    • Report status on tasks and assignments.
    • Must be able to generate preliminary and detailed designs as required for enhancements or modifications to existing designs, requiring the application of current industry design concepts and utilization of basic technical writing skills.
    • Must be able to perform effectively as part of a project "team".
